Bulgaria – Bulgaria's capital is Sofia

(Pronounced buhl-gair-ee-uh and soh-fee-uh)

To remember the capital of Bulgaria, use the following mnemonic:

The bull glared (Bulgaria) at her but she just sat on the sofa with no fear (Sofia).

Interesting facts about Sofia:

- Ancient Heritage: Sofia is one of the oldest cities in Europe, with a history that spans over 7,000 years, evident in the ancient Roman ruins and medieval churches scattered throughout the modern capital.

- Mineral Springs: The city is built directly over natural thermal mineral springs, and public fountains providing warm, drinkable mineral water can still be found in the center of town.

- Peak Elevation: Nestled at the foot of the massive Vitosha Mountain, Sofia is one of the highest capital cities in Europe, offering residents and visitors easy access to alpine skiing and hiking just a short trip from the urban center.
